Output 5c307e0942034da218827bebe67617871fe13fd068355b37ee275ee08763416d:89

value
342374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f83f9008df2b02e694054c367f8f162859708b6a OP_EQUAL
address
3QKdeXXBDoLKRUbqTkWP7HpFkRnTUJcWD7
transaction
5c307e0942034da218827bebe67617871fe13fd068355b37ee275ee08763416d